Does Greater Regional Medical Center sponsor H-1B visas and green cards?
Yes. In 2025, Greater Regional Medical Center filed 1 H-1B Labor Condition Applications (LCAs) and 0 PERM green card petitions with the Department of Labor.Greater Regional Medical Center pays a median H-1B salary of $65,520 for visa-sponsored positions.Greater Regional Medical Center is not classified as an H-1B dependent employer.
